In this episode, Dr. Murrow reviews an integrative framework for the therapeutic alliance by authors Koole & Tschacher (2016). Among many things, this framework encourages the therapist’s awareness of multiple facets in the therapy session and it even makes space for these to be assessed in different time horizons.

This episode will validate your experience in terms of the wide variety of factors that affect your session, and it will also encourage your awareness of and abilities in attending to them.
